Climate Superfund Legislation Fails in Virginia State Legislature

Virginia’s attempt to join a national wave of climate superfund legislation was immediately rejected after a bipartisan vote against the newly introduced bill in a key committee this week.

Like similar climate superfund legislation introduced elsewhere around the country, SB420, the “Extreme Weather Taxpayer Protection Program and Fund” bill, aimed to penalize U.S. energy companies for historic greenhouse gas emissions and for cost recovery payments to the Commonwealth.
